About The Sandlot (USA, 1993, 101 minutes) “You’re killin’ me, Smalls!” Scotty Smalls tells his story as the new kid on the block in this family favorite. Urged to make friends, but socially inept, he tries out for the local pickup team to ward off his mother. The ringleader takes the unlikely prospect under his wing, paving the way for antics galore. A highly quotable film with appearances from Karen Allen, James Earl Jones, and Denis Leary.
